Inheritance of Ash and Light is not about opposition. It is what remains after it. The conflict has passed. The distance has settled. What is left is not resolution, but recognition. Both figures remain, but they are no longer defined by what they represent. No authority. No rebellion. No tension to resolve. Only the quiet presence of something that has already unfolded. The weight is not in action, but in what has accumulated. They do not confront each other. They do not turn away. They hold a position, as if the outcome is already known. What was once a struggle is now a consequence. This work exists in that stillness. Not calm, but the absence of resistance. A space where nothing can be undone, only carried. There are no answers here. Only the understanding that what we become is not decided in a moment. It is built, over time, through what we choose, what we ignore, and what we allow. Ash or light. Nothing else remains.
